SA making progress in providing ICT to rural areas - Mbeki

Posted 8th September 2008 at 09:35 AM by NewsTracker (Tracking the News)
By Bathandwa Mbola

Limpopo – South Africa has made some progress regarding the provision of Information and Communication Technology (ICT) to South Africans, especially those in rural areas, says President Thabo Mbeki on Sunday.

President Mbeki was briefing reporters after the eighth Presidential International Advisory Council on Information Society and Development (PIAC on ISAD), which advises him and his Cabinet in the areas of ICT.

Expo to promote Indigenous Knowledge system

Posted 4th August 2008 at 06:01 PM by NewsTracker (Tracking the News)
By Nthambeleni Gabara

Pretoria - A week-long expo to promote Indigenous Knowledge Systems (IKS) will kick off in Pretoria, on Monday.

Science and Technology Minister, Mosibudi Mangena will officially open the expo which will be attended by IKS holders and practitioners from around the country.
The IKS expo is organised by the department, in partnership with the Northern Flagship Institution and other government departments and science councils.

Africa to get Microsoft innovation centres

Posted 17th July 2008 at 12:29 PM by NewsTracker (Tracking the News)
Johannesburg – Head of Microsoft South Africa, David Ives, has announced that four Microsoft Innovation Centres will be built in Africa in the next two years, two of which will be located in South Africa.
He said the centres act as economic ‘spark plugs' for local innovators and the local software industry.

New website to expose child pornography

Posted 1st July 2008 at 05:54 PM by NewsTracker (Tracking the News)
By Edwin Tshivhidzo, Tel: (012) 314-2454

Johannesburg - Members of the public can now anonymously report any images of sexual abuse discovered on the internet through a newly launched website.

The website, www.fpbprochild.org.za, which is available 24 hours, seven days a week was launched in Johannesburg on Tuesday by Deputy Minister of Home Affairs Malusi Gigaba.
